Hyunmi Baek is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Communication and Information Systems and Management. According to data from OpenAlex, Hyunmi Baek has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 686 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 9 papers in Communication and 7 papers in Information Systems and Management. Recurrent topics in Hyunmi Baek’s work include Digital Marketing and Social Media (17 papers),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(7 papers) and Social Media and Politics (7 papers). Hyunmi Baek is often cited by papers focused on Digital Marketing and Social Media (17 papers),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(7 papers) and Social Media and Politics (7 papers). Hyunmi Baek coll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Latvia. Hyunmi Baek's co-authors include JoongHo Ahn, Youngseok Choi, Hee‐Dong Yang, Seongcheol Kim, Moonkyoung Jang, Saerom Lee, JungJoo Jahng, Thomas Hove, Hye‐Jin Paek and Dam Hee Kim and has published in prestigious journals such as Computers in Human Behavior, Frontiers in Psychology and IEEE Transactions on Vehicular Technology.
